English Practice Test (Open Cloze)

Level: B2-C1

Use one word to fill in the gaps:

1.I am bitterly jealous ______ my friends’ higher wages in the company.

2.Any changes should be introduced step ______ step.

3.The owner of the cafe treated us ______ the house.

4.He will protect himself ______ any cost.

5.The rental fees should be paid ______ advance.

6.My great interest ______ Unidentified Flying Objects seems quite odd to my friends.

7.It still makes me angry ______ the way it all turned out.

8.The football star is hiding ______ he curious journalists.

9.Everyone who read my name laughed except ______ him.

10.Customers used to complain —the high prices of food, meat ______ particular.

11.Learning this long definition ______ heart, seems an impossible task.

12.Instead ______ a long speech at the beginning of the meeting, the chairman only gave a short welcome to all the participants.

13.Only Mark was keen ______ going fishing early in the morning.

14.Tell the children to stop fooling around or I'll lose my patience ______ them.

15.His words cut ground from ______ me.

16.There is a thunderstorm hanging ______ .

17.Suddenly they heard a noise downstairs. Everyone pricked ______ their ears.

18.There was no one in the room. So, the blame rests ______ you.

19.1 don’t really care ______ tea. I like coffee.

20.We’ll put the meeting ______ till another time.

21.My friend does not live in this street. He has recently moved ______ another flat.

22.Have you secured an actor ______ the part of Hamlet?

23.John has just split ______ his girl-friend.

24.It was strange that he had gone away that afternoon saying a word to her.

25.I was out in the thunderstorm, and I got absolutely soaked ______ the skin.

26.I’ve written almost the whole report, but I have to fill ______ the details.

27.Whether you like it or not, you will have to carry ______ this plan.

28.It’s ______ of the question that he should visit us.

29.Would you put a sweater ______? - It’s cold outside.

30.Let’s turn on the tape-recorder and dance ______ the music:

31.You will have to get some more books ______ English literature.

32."Is that your own book?" - "No, I borrowed it ______ the library.”

33.Perhaps she didn’t know him very well, but Charlie didn’t know him ______ all.

34.The daughter didn’t take ______ her mother.

35.He did it just ______ purpose. Everything he does is always deliberate since it gives him pleasure to make us angry.

36.They have made an urgent request ______ international aid.

37.He rescued the man ______ drowning.

38.She told me all ______ it without reserve.

39.All ______ all, their trip was very interesting.

40.He reserved his comments ______ the boss.

41.There’s a strong resemblance ______ Susan and Robert.

42.To carry ______ this plan would require increasing our staff by 50 %.

43.The accident resulted — the death of two passengers.

44.______ my way to the theatre I met a friend of mine.

45.This statue was erected ______ honour of the great man.

46.She was very tired and her nerves were all ______ edge.

47.How dare you go and poke your nose ______ my family affairs?

48.Everyone understood that the answer was good ______ nothing.

49.Wherever he goes he is kept ______ strict observation now.

50.The storm carried the sails ______ .

51.He caught hold ______ her hand and they hurried out.

52.Going to the river is ______ of the question, it’s too cold to bathe today.

53.The chief has always had two or three devoted people ______ elbow.

54.It only happened due ______ his being so careless about his work.

55.He took one of his hands ______ the pocket.

56.When lie came then; the discussion was ______ full swing.

57.I lived in London ______ myself

58.When tired they used to lean ______ the low stone.

59.You could be ______ the greatest use; you could cheer and comfort me.

60.It you need any help, I and my car are ______ your service.

61.Have you set a date ______ your wedding yet

62.They bought some drinks at the bar, then sat ______ at a table.

63.______ all you’ve eaten, it serves you right if you feel ill.

64.The doctor sent me ______ bed, since I’ve got a high temperature.

65.He did not bear much resemblance ______ the man whose photo I’d seen.

66.Will they publish the results ______ their research.

67.Have you made the reservation ______ our holidays yet?

68.The police said they wouldn’t rest all the criminals were caught.

69.She holds a very responsible position and is not going to give it ______ .

70.She wrote a letter ______ a sure hand.

71.The lift broke ______ and we had to walk up to the tenth floor.

72.1 shall be there ______ certain.

73.How do you put ______ with that noise all day long?

74.He promised to send a reply by return ______ the post.

75.The rules ______ the club do not permit smoking.

76.His teenage son is going a difficult period at the moment.

77.She is married ______ a well-known artist.

78.I’d like to get acquainted ______ your plan.

79.A world-famous violinist is playing ______ tonight’s concert.

80.Are you through ______ your homework?

81.He got an excellent mark ______ Physics.

82.It is not pleasant to go ______ bus on such a fine day. Let’s go on foot.

83.______ the age of twenty-five she left the place and became an actress at a small theatre in a large city.

84.She thought she must talk it ______ with her mother.

85.Take this saucepan and fill it ______ water,

86.There was an accident this morning. The bus crashed ______ a car.

87.I prefer tea ______ coffee.

88.To put it ______ a nutshell, this is a waste of time.

89.Don’t look out of the window. Concentrate ______ your work.

90.The party ended up ______ a song.

91.I came to know all about it quite ______ chance.

92.It was very kind ______ you to help me.

93.His new book is very much the same ______ his last one.

94.I found the ring______ the very bottom of the box.

95.What prevented them ______ coming, to see us?

96.We have voted ______ moving, to Oxford.

97..I congratulated Ann ______ passing the exam,

98.She is bound______ pass the exam.

99.Carol went to work in ______ of feeling ill.

100.Our neighbours were angry ______ us for making so much noise last night.

101. I didn’t intend to take your umbrella. I took it ______ mistake.

102. I didn’t have any money. I had to borrow some ______ a friend of mine.

103. I have danced with you ______ least a dozen times now and you must tell me your name.

104. As a matter ______ fact I don’t think you need be afraid of that.

105.There has been an increase ______ the number of road accidents recently.

106.Nobody knows what the cause ______ the explosion was.

107.Faded jeans are ______ of fashion now. I will not wear them.

108.We got ______ the 6.45 train.

109.The train was travelling ______ 120 miles an hour.

110.I’ve put on a lot of weight. I’ 11 have to go a diet.

111.The letter is not very easy to read because it is writtenpencil.

112.I fell asleep ______ I was watching television.

113.Everyone is ill at home. Our house is ______ a hospital.

114.There was an accident this morning. A bus collided ______ a car.

115.She was not persuaded ______ the argument.

116. It seems that there is no way ______ of our difficulty.

117.I found the two boys fighting and stepped ______ to separate them.

118. We haven’t enough books ______ everybody.

119.I know he was being waited yesterday ______ 10 till 11 o’clock p.m.

120.Our building firm is very busy ______ the moment.

121.The letter is written ______ a formal style.

122.People who cannot speak or hear can talk ______ using signs

123.This new evidence throws doubt ______ the theory.

124.You’d better put ______ with these small discomforts.
